1 When the day of Pentecost had arrived, they were all together in one place. 2 Suddenly a

sound like that of a violent rushing wind came from heaven, and it filled the whole house

where they were staying. 3 And tongues, like flames of fire that were divided, appeared to

them and rested on each one of them.

Acts 2:1-3

The fire of change came down (2-4)

• Function of the Holy Spirit changed.• The believers were changed.• Languages were changed.– The Pentecost experience involves intelligible

communication to those in the Jewish crowd.– The believers began to speak.– The presence of the Holy Spirit changes people into

witnesses.

Page 9: Acts: The Journey of the Early Church The Journey Begins with Fire (Part 2) Acts 2:1-13

The fire compelled people to speak of the magnificent acts of God. (5-11)

• The Spirit drew multitudes together.• The Spirit allowed everyone to hear in their own

language.• The work of the Spirit amazed all those in the crowd.• The Spirit compelled the believers to speak of “the

magnificent acts of God.”
